No Respite From Heatwave: Orange Warning For Six Dists

Bhubaneswar: There is no respite from the heatwave condition till tomorrow. The Bhubaneswar Meteorological Centre has issued a severe heatwave warning in the state until March 18.

According to the Meteorological Centre, the temperature in various districts of interior and western Odisha is likely to cross 41 degrees Celsius. The weather agency has issued an orange warning for six districts and a yellow warning for 15 districts for today.

While there is a possibility of severe heatwave conditions in Jharsuguda, Sambalpur, and Mayurbhanj districts, heatwave conditions have been predicted in Sundargarh, Boudh, and Balangir districts. Khordha, Jajpur, Kendrapara, Puri, and Jagatsinghpur may experience hot weather, while night temperatures may rise due to humidity.

On Friday, Jharsuguda was the hottest city, recording 41.8 degrees Celsius, while Sambalpur recorded 40.3 degrees Celsius, Hirakud 40.1 degrees Celsius, and Bhubaneswar recorded 37.2 degrees Celsius.
